Physical Therapy to Boost Equilibrium and also Inner Ear Concerns
Vestibular rehab is a type of physical treatment that can benefit individuals with inner ear or equilibrium issues. It aids your mind discover methods to use other detects (such as vision) to compensate for vertigo.
The workouts are usually personalized to meet a individual’s specific needs. They may consist of eye as well as head movements, equilibrium training, or various other maneuvers, relying on what’s triggering your signs.
Vestibular recovery is generally performed on an outpatient basis, but it can also be carried out in a healthcare facility or home setting.
Canalith Repositioning, Also Known as the Epley Maneuver
Canalith repositioning, also referred to as the Epley maneuver, is a technique that includes a series of special head and also body language.
The purpose is to move crystals from the fluid-filled semicircular canals of your inner ear to a various area, so they can be soaked up by the body.
Canalith repositioning involves the adhering to actions:
You sit on an examination table with your eyes open as well as your head turned 45 degrees to the right.
You lie on your back swiftly with your head hanging off the end of the table.
Your doctor transforms your head 90 degrees to the left, and you hold this position for concerning 30 secs.
Your doctor transforms your head an additional 90 degrees to the left while you revolve your body in the same direction. This position is held for an additional 30 secs.
You sit up on the left side of the exam table.
The procedure can be duplicated on both sides up until you feel alleviation.
You’ll probably have signs of vertigo during your therapy. You may require to stay upright for 24 hours following your treatment to stop crystals from returning to the semicircular canals.
A physician or physical therapist usually carries out canalith repositioning, however you may be demonstrated how to do customized exercises at home.

Canalith repositioning is very reliable for people with benign paroxysmal positional vertigo (BPPV)– one of the most typical source of vertigo. Outcomes differ, however research reveals an approximate success price of 70 percent on the very first effort and also virtually 100 percent on successive efforts. (2 )
If the crystals return right into your semicircular canals, your physician can repeat the therapy.
You should tell your healthcare provider if you have any one of the complying with prior to having this therapy:
A neck trouble
A back condition
Rheumatoid joint inflammation
A removed retina in your eye
Capillary or heart problems.

Surgical procedure: an Uncommon Treatment for Grandfather Clauses.
Surgical treatment isn’t a common treatment for vertigo, yet it’s occasionally required.
You could need a operation if your symptoms are brought on by an hidden problem, such as a lump or an injury to your mind or neck.
In unusual scenarios, medical professionals may suggest canal connecting surgical treatment for individuals with BPPV when other treatments fall short. With this treatment, a bone plug is made use of to block an area of your internal ear and protect against the semicircular canals from replying to particle movements. The success rate is around 90 percent. (3 ).
An additional surgical procedure, called labyrinthectomy, disables the vestibular maze in your bad ear and also permits the various other ear to regulate equilibrium. This treatment is rarely done yet may be recommended if you have substantial hearing loss or vertigo that hasn’t replied to various other therapies.
Seldom, people with Meniere’s disease may additionally require surgery, such as a shunt surgical treatment, to aid signs.
A procedure to plug a leakage in the inner ear is in some cases utilized for individuals with perilymph fistula.
Other operations might be necessary, depending upon what’s creating your vertigo episodes.
Injections: When Other Treatments Haven’t Worked.
In cases in which patients have not reacted to other treatments, shots are often utilized to assist individuals with vertigo signs and symptoms. The antibiotic gentamicin (Garamycin) can be injected into your inner ear to disable balance. This enables the unaffected ear to execute balance features.

Sometimes Vertigo Vanishes All by itself.
Your vertigo might vanish on its own, without any specific therapy. For instance, individuals with BPPV typically notice that their signs vanish within a couple of weeks or months. (3 ).
Your physician can aid you identify if therapy is necessary for your condition.
